embedrock is an OpenAI-compatible embedding proxy for Amazon Bedrock. It translates standard /v1/embeddings API calls into Bedrock InvokeModel requests, allowing any tool that speaks the OpenAI embeddings API to use Bedrock models with zero code changes.

The shared type layer. No logic, just shapes.
Embedderinterface —Embed(text string) ([]float64, error). The only abstraction boundary. Everything depends on this.- Request types —
EmbeddingRequest(single) andEmbeddingRequestBatch(array), matching OpenAI's API. - Response types —
EmbeddingResponse,EmbeddingData,Usage— exact OpenAI format. EmbedError— typed error for embedding failures.
The real Embedder implementation. Handles two model families:
- Titan —
{"inputText": "..."}→{"embedding": [...]} - Cohere v3 —
{"texts": [...], "input_type": "search_query"}→{"embeddings": [[...]]} - Cohere v4 — same request, different response:
{"embeddings": {"float": [[...]]}}
Model family is detected by ID prefix (cohere. vs everything else). The shared invoke() method handles the Bedrock SDK call.
Implements http.Handler. Routes:
GET /— Health check with configured model namePOST /v1/embeddings— Main endpoint, OpenAI-format request/responseOPTIONS /v1/embeddings— CORS preflight
Input parsing handles three formats: typed single, typed batch, and raw JSON fallback.
Parses flags, creates embedder, starts server. Version info injected at build time via ldflags.
Testability. All handler tests use MockEmbedder — no AWS credentials needed. The handler doesn't know about Bedrock.
One binary, one flag (--model). No separate "mode" or "provider" config. The model ID already encodes which family it belongs to.
The proxy uses the EC2 instance profile — exposing it would let anyone embed on your AWS bill. Use --host 0.0.0.0 explicitly if needed.
- Single static binary (~9MB), zero runtime dependencies
- Cross-compiles trivially (linux/arm64, linux/amd64, darwin/*)
- ~2MB RSS vs ~80MB for Node.js equivalent

16 tests across two files:
bedrock_test.go— model detection (isCohere,isCohereV4)handler_test.go— health, single/batch embeddings, Cohere v4, model passthrough, default fallback, error propagation, CORS, invalid methods/paths/bodies
